Skip to content

Commit

Permalink
fix: Поправлена ошибка получения свойств объектов кластера.
Browse files Browse the repository at this point in the history
+ Незначительные правки.
  • Loading branch information
arkuznetsov committed Apr 19, 2024
1 parent 382582e commit c095210
Show file tree
Hide file tree
Showing 4 changed files with 12 additions and 12 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-117,7 +117,7 @@
// РежимОбновления - Число - 1 - обновить данные принудительно (вызов RAC)
// 0 - обновить данные только по таймеру
// -1 - не обновлять данные
// ЭлементыКакСоответствия - Булево, - Истина - элементы результата будут преобразованы в соответствия
// ЭлементыКакСоответствия - Булево - Истина - элементы результата будут преобразованы в соответствия
// Строка с именами свойств в качестве ключей
// <Имя поля> - элементы результата будут преобразованы в соответствия
// со значением указанного поля в качестве ключей ("Имя"|"ИмяРАК")
Expand Down
9 changes: 6 additions & 3 deletions src/Классы/ОбъектКластера.os
Original file line number Diff line number Diff line change
Expand Up @@ -7,8 +7,8 @@
// Codebase: https://github.com/ArKuznetsov/irac/
// ----------------------------------------------------------

Перем Объект_Тип;
Перем Объект_Свойства;
Перем Объект_Тип; // Строка - тип объекта кластера
Перем Объект_Свойства; // Строка - свойства объекта кластера

Перем Кластер_Агент; // - УправлениеКластером1С - родительский объект агента кластера

Expand Down Expand Up @@ -67,11 +67,14 @@
//
// Параметры:
// ИмяПоля - Строка - Имя параметра кластера
// РежимОбновления - Число - 1 - обновить данные принудительно (вызов RAC)
// 0 - обновить данные только по таймеру
// -1 - не обновлять данные
//
// Возвращаемое значение:
// Произвольный - значение параметра объекта кластера 1С
//
Функция Получить(ИмяПоля) Экспорт
Функция Получить(ИмяПоля, РежимОбновления = 0) Экспорт

ЗначениеПоля = Неопределено;

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-1497,7 +1497,7 @@
Если МакетПараметров.Существует() Тогда

ПараметрыПоУмолчанию = ПрочитатьПараметрыТестированияИзФайла(ПутьКФайлуПараметров);

Для Каждого ТекПараметр Из ПараметрыПоУмолчанию Цикл
Параметры.Вставить(ТекПараметр.Ключ, ТекПараметр.Значение);
КонецЦикла;
Expand Down
11 changes: 4 additions & 7 deletions tests/irac-test.os
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,6 @@
#Использовать fs
#Использовать moskito

Перем ЮнитТест;
Перем ИспользоватьМок;
Перем АгентКластера;
Перем ИсполнительКоманд;
Expand Down Expand Up @@ -44,11 +43,11 @@
ИсполнительКоманд = Мок.Получить(Новый ИсполнительКоманд());
Иначе
ИсполнительКоманд = Новый ИсполнительКоманд("8.3");
КонецЕсли;
КонецЕсли;
КонецЕсли;

АгентКластера.УстановитьИсполнительКоманд(ИсполнительКоманд);

КонецПроцедуры // ПередЗапускомТеста()

// Функция возвращает список тестов для выполнения
Expand All @@ -60,9 +59,7 @@
// Массив - Массив имен процедур-тестов
//
Функция ПолучитьСписокТестов(Тестирование) Экспорт

ЮнитТест = Тестирование;


СписокТестов = Новый Массив;
СписокТестов.Добавить("ТестДолжен_ПодключитьсяКСерверуАдминистрирования");
СписокТестов.Добавить("ТестДолжен_ПолучитьСписокАдминистраторовАгента");
Expand Down Expand Up @@ -125,7 +122,7 @@
СписокТестов.Добавить("ТестДолжен_ПолучитьПараметрыОграниченийРесурсов");

Возврат СписокТестов;

КонецФункции // ПолучитьСписокТестов()

// Процедура выполняется после запуска теста
Expand Down

0 comments on commit c095210

Please sign in to comment.